The answer to 'electrical meter dimming lights' is that a dimming or flickering electrical meter is often caused by an issue with the electrical load or wiring in the home. This can lead to lights dimming or flickering when certain appliances or devices are turned on. Common causes include loose connections, faulty wiring, or a problem with the electrical panel or meter itself.

If you notice your electrical meter dimming your lights, it's important to have a professional electrician inspect the electrical system to diagnose and fix the issue. Attempting to troubleshoot or repair the electrical system yourself can be dangerous and should only be done by a licensed and qualified electrician.
